Within the ADAPT initiative, this summer, two national studies with the topic of Nature-Based Solutions (NBSs) were prepared. The first study was carried out in the territory of Bosnia and Herzegovina, and the second one in Serbia. Both studies are available at the IUCN library in a digital format.

The authors of the studies are national experts for NBSs – Tanja Popovicki for Serbia and Marijana Kapovic Solomun for Bosnia and Herzegovina.

The studies map the basic climate risks and dangers, as well as their causes, provide a precise analysis of relevant existing projects which are defined as NBSs and make recommendations for the implementation of those solutions on a national level.

Both studies are an overview of ecosystem services and relevant practices for adapting to the changed climate conditions to the end of reducing the risk of disasters. Based on the information from the relevant global databases, as well as consultations with key national partners, the studies have managed to identify the priority locations for the implementation of NBSs which are further used for the selection of the NBS pilot location in Serbia (Gledic) and the NBS feasibility study in Bosnia and Herzegovina. The pilot project in Serbia is planned for this autumn.


The studies about NBSs for other economies of the Western Balkans in which ADAPT carries out its activities are in the final phase of preparation, which includes commentary by national associates and the authors of the publication.
